Nehemiah Blackstock letters

 Collection
Identifier: MVC098
Abstract

This collection is primarily correspondence written by Nehemiah Blackstock, of Ventura, to Spencer Roane Thorpe between 1883-1886. Between 1883 and 1886, Thorpe primarily lived in San Francisco, California, permanently moving to Ventura for a short time in 1886. Correspondence mainly covers matters related to real estate purchases and management of agricultural land. Some financial and legal records from approximately 1878-1886 are also included.

Dates: 1878-1886

Peoples Lumber Company records

 Collection
Identifier: MVC041
Abstract The People's Lumber Company was a lumber and construction supply company established in Ventura in 1890. The company was the main supplier of lumber and construction supplies until it reoriented its business to focus on real estate investments in the 1960s. This collection contains the records of the People's Lumber Company in its various forms through the establishment of the Real Estate Investment Trust of California.
